The EPA recommends indoor humidity levels should be kept between 30 and 50 percent to stop the growth of mold and discourage pests such as cockroaches and dust mites. Relative humidity: the amount of water vapor present in air expressed as a percentage of the amount needed for saturation at the same temperature. Specific humidity is approximately equal to the mixing ratio, which is defined as the ratio of the mass of water vapor in an air parcel to the mass of dry air for the same parcel.
